form data as $1, shell script & cgi
I have a form page custlookup.html:
Should execute as follows on the server:
% ./scopelookup.sh $devid
I tried appending the method with the $devid but that doesn't seem to work:
Try modifying the script to use FORM_devid rather
than passing variables to the script. (Assuming you're
P.S.: Moved to PROGRAMMING.
Thanks for the reply Tinkster. I wasn't aware of proccgi until you mentioned it. I just googled it and it appears to be a variable translator from web form to shell scripts which appears to be exactly what i need. But as I mentioned my scripting skills are joke worthy so I have some basic questions for you:
1 - how do I determine if proccgi is installed on the server?
2 - how can I troubleshoot my issues since monitoring the error.log in apache doesn't seem to provide any errors. I'd like to see what variable if any the script is taking so that I may attempt to correct it.
With the current config i get the following one liner result on my web page:
I think simply using HTTP GET rather than POST will cause the web server to pass arguments via the CGI commandline, rather than STDIN. Your CGI will get arguments from all form elements, and they will be of the form "?key1=value1&key2=value2&...." You should be able to parse out the key/value pairs in your script, especially since your list of form elements appears to be small.
|All times are GMT -5. The time now is 09:26 AM.|